Device, method, and graphical user interface for copying user interface objects between content regions

Abstract
An electronic device displays a user interface object in a first content region on a touch-sensitive display. The device detects a first finger input on the user interface object. While detecting the first finger input, the device detects a second finger input on the touch-sensitive display. When the first finger input is an M-finger contact, wherein M is an integer, in response to detecting the second finger input, the device selects a second content region and displays a copy of the user interface object in the second content region. After detecting the second finger input, the device detects termination of the first finger input while the copy of the user interface object is displayed in the second content region. In response to detecting termination of the first finger input, the device maintains display of the copy of the user interface object in the second content region.
